initiation

Vocabulary Word

Definition
When you hear 'initiation', think of it as the formal start or launch of something like a new project, plan or idea. It's like the starting whistle in a sports game.
Examples in Different Contexts
In the arts, 'initiation' can mean the start of a new artistic endeavor or project. A creative director might express, 'The initiation of this campaign was inspired by contemporary art movements.'
